A Sixth Power List Honor Reflects Byron Kirkland’s Leadership and Impact
Business North Carolina has again recognized Smith Anderson Managing Partner Byron Kirkland among the state’s most influential private-sector leaders, naming him to its 2026 Power List for the sixth consecutive year. The honor reflects Byron’s outstanding track record as a corporate lawyer, firm leader and advocate for a strong workplace culture rooted in collaboration, client service and community engagement.
Byron, who has more than 35 years of experience as a corporate lawyer, advises clients on private equity transactions, mergers and acquisitions, securities and general corporate matters. He also maintains an active venture capital and private equity fund practice, representing funds in formation, investments and portfolio company transactions, and he regularly counsels both emerging and established companies on strategic growth and capital-raising initiatives.
Since being elected managing partner in 2020, Byron has led the firm through a period of continued growth, expanding the team to more than 170 attorneys and strengthening its presence in the Triangle’s business community. Under his leadership, the firm has earned repeated recognition as one of the region’s best places to work, while also expanding its commitment to community engagement through initiatives such as its annual Day of Service and long history of supporting local nonprofits through the Smith Anderson Community Fund. Byron also serves on the boards of the Greater Raleigh Chamber of Commerce, NC TECH and the Miracle League of the Triangle, further reflecting his focus on culture, collaboration and meaningful community impact.
In addition to his recognition on the Power List, Byron has received numerous other honors reflecting his leadership and client service. He is ranked as an Eminent Practitioner by Chambers USA, recognized in The Best Lawyers in America® across multiple corporate and transactional categories and has been named a “Lawyer of the Year” in several practice areas. He has also been recognized by Triangle Business Journal with Corporate Leadership and CEO of the Year Awards, and by BTI Consulting Group as a Client Service All-Star.
